## Partner SFTP Drop — Marlowe Freight

Files land nightly between 02:00–03:30 UTC in the inbound drop. Watcher job `marlowe-ingest` picks them up; if nothing arrives by 04:00, the Quillhook alert fires. Do NOT re-request files from Marlowe before checking the quarantine folder — malformed headers get parked there silently. Retries are safe; ingest is idempotent on file checksum. Rotation of the drop credentials is quarterly, owned by platform. Full escalation steps and contacts are on the runbook page.

dashboard of taduf-tahof = https://confluence.tolvaqlabs.internal/browse/browse/display/f01240ca

## Releases

New to the Pipewright team: broker upgrades ship as versioned bundles, one minor version at a time — never skip versions, the on-disk queue format migrates incrementally. Drain consumers, apply the bundle to one node, verify replication, then roll the rest. Every bundle must be signed before the deploy tool accepts it, using the key below.

rollout seal: bky4_x7Gc

## Environments: Ledgerline Export Service

Spreadsheet exports in the Quarryside staging cluster consume markedly more memory than production because row streaming is disabled there for debugging. Reviewers should note that any change to the chunk size must be validated against the 500k-row benchmark workbook before merge. Heap limits differ per environment, so compare carefully. The current staging configuration is as follows.

deployment values, yadug-bawif:
[framir]
team = pelox
access_code = ac_a38ab2
owner = tamion.julael
host = framir.tolvaqlabs.test
port = 11211
peer = tammir.zemvargrid.local
salt = 2215ef03
pin = 1541

## ChipGate Reader Basics

You'll be working on ChipGate, the timing-chip reader used at the Harrowfield Marathon. Each mat streams raw RFID reads to the aggregator; your job is the parsing layer only. Never modify the dedup window — race officials tune it per event. Test against the replay fixtures in `fixtures/2024-sim`, not live mats. Builds deploy through the staging rig in the Dunmore office. For access to the replay archive, send a request to the timing team.

pager mailbox: fenael_wenael@norvalabs.corp